Come Horn
---------
- Permissions, sync, metadata good.

- 16.515: I don't think a jump / minijack is warranted here.
- 18.799, 20.455, etc.: Should be on the 24th at 18.825--this is the same sequence as at e.g. 17.170.
- 20.756: This burst should end at the 16th.
- 21.480: This sound is very soft, suggest removing minijack.
- 23.446: Burst should continue through to the 8th like at 21.791.
- 29.653: Compared to your previous 48th bursts, this one is much less warranted. Suggest reducing.
- 31.515: Should be 32nds instead of 16th gluts, as at 28.205.
- 33.067: I think you could make this burst more interesting by reducing to 48ths into 32nds and patterning it more intricately.
- 36.273: This rhythm doesn't make sense considering the sound you're following is essentially a constant tone.
- 38.549, 38.860: Why are these jumps?
- 42.894: Suggest reducing right hand bias in this pattern, particularly given what comes before.
- 47.963, 48.170, 54.584: Should be singles, not jumps. See (for instance) 46.308.
- 49.627: This should be the jump, not 49.515.
- 53.308: Should be 32nd, not 24th. Also 53.549 should be on the next 24th.
- 59.860: Recommend moving this off column 3--anchoring the 12ths beforehand makes sense, but this is just percussion and has nothing in common with them.
- 60.067, 63.377, etc.: You don't usually follow this with a jump (though doing so would be consistent if you want to make the change everywhere), and the 16th should be moved to the next 24th.
- 70.023: Shouldn't be minijack.
- 72.687: Dumping 32nds doesn't really make sense here, and you just use a jump at 73.101.
- 73.929: This is a 24th gallop (i.e. 32 [124]), not a 32nd triplet.
- 76.136: No reason for these 48ths.
- 81.170: This sound continues until the 32nd before the beat, may make the most sense just to do straight 48ths through to the beat.
- 82.825: These two sounds are completely different, a jumpjack doesn't make sense here.
- 84.713: I'm not a fan of mixing and matching quantizations like this, why not just make this straight 48ths or straight 64ths?
- 85.463: Ghost note.

In the interest of brevity, I'll only give playability-related notes from here on, but please do look through the rest of the file for the same types of issues described above, particularly inconsistencies regarding swing and burst usage and mixed quantizations in non-polyrhythmic bursts.

- 91.722: This burst is way overdone, and it's not clear why there's a random gap in the 48ths nor a random 48th in the 32nds.
- 94.825-96.274, 98.136, etc.: Unclear why you follow percussion here when the melody's still going on and you only follow melody in surrounding areas.
- 139.308/etc.: These 48ths are pretty dense, may be worth it to reduce jumps to singles for a more consistent difficulty curve.
- 152.342: OHT feels excessive for this sound.
- 153.998: No reason for this much right hand bias with the minijack into OHT.

- This file is on the right track as fun factor goes, but it needs significant polishing for consistency, and the mixed quantizations should go. [5.5/10]

Come Horn - Mi40 (6.0/10)

Permission check = good
metadata = good

-9.380: Why do you step this part of the lyrics, but not 2.760
***18.799, 20.455, 25.420 etc etc: this should be a white note at 18.834 instead, you start the chart by stepping it as 24ths (which is fine as long as you're consistent) and then later on you step them too early. It arbitrarily ups the difficulty.
-23.032 and 23.239: These 2 jumps go to fairly different sounds and should probably be on different columns

-32.498: This 32nd is a ghost note.
-36.618: This 24th is slightly off and should be a 192nd at 36.592.
-46.825: No 8th to the melody here? You do it later on.
-53.308: Why is this a 24th instead of a 32nd?
-61.653: Why don't you start following the melody here? like so:
https://imgur.com/a/23XsQbD

-62.549: PR should follow A C B here
-69.377: These 32nds feel too slow...
-69.998: These 64th's should just be an 8th and a 24th
-72.739: 32nd seems like a ghost note
-73.411, 80.067, 81.687 etc: Now it's a 16th note instead of a 24th? And 78.386 is a white note again.
-74.110: This 64th feels noticeably off, if you want to make it a green hand, move it down with a subbeat otherwise just make it an 8th hand instead.
-75.687: The glitchiness starts at this 16th,
-76.170: I would remove the 48th since the overall sound of this is very different than the 48th bursts before it and the percussion on the 12th and 8th notes is much louder as well. Maybe something like this?
https://imgur.com/a/AowPkZo

-85.463: This 32nd is a ghost note.
-88.205: This 8th should be moved up slightly to 88.176
-89.549: Missing note
-91.722: This burst is speeding up, but you're stepping it as if it's slowing down.
-99.248: This 64th is too early, if you want to have it as a green note, move it down with a subbeat otherwise make it a 16th note instead.
-99.377: Why is this a jump?
-99.929: Now they're 24ths again, and sometimes you step them as 16th jumps as well. You go back and forth between 16th jumps and 24th singles in this section. I'm guessing the 16th jumps are for when the glitchy sound comes in, but at least make them 24th jumps then.
-105.584, 105.894, 106.101: The glitchiness here is way different than the other jumps that are there, why is there no distinction between the jumps? I feel these notes should be emphasised in some way.
-119.791: This 24th should probably not form a jack with 119.653 since they're different sounds. Instead I would put it on [3] to be congruent with the 12th at 120.411 Like this:
https://imgur.com/a/IbRfNMJ

-121.101 - 123.998: I think you should step the 'Ah's' here, since you start stepping them at 123.998
-126.067: These 32nd's feel too slow, you're stepping way slower stuff as 48th's earlier
-136.851: I would just step the kicks/snares here, this roll feels way too fast because alot of the sounds you're stepping are barely audible on 1.0
-164.653: Why is this a jump? It has about the same intensity as the 192nd before the hand.
-172.205: You're stepping the 'the flashbulb' part of the vocals, but you ignore the rest. I would much rather you either step the vocals or end the song with a cut and a fade-out before the vocals.

Even though I put down a lot of notes the chart isn't too bad, it just suffers from inconsistencies and quite a few misrhythms throughout. I would take these notes into consideration and adjust the chart accordingly.
